More than a decade has passed since the release of Bioshock Infinite's expansion, Burial at Sea. The development of Infinite led to significant restructuring within Irrational Games, which transformed into Ghost Story Games. Ghost Story's first title, Judas, aims to revive single-player narrative-driven shooters. Ken Levine expressed optimism about the demand for such games despite a shift in the industry towards multiplayer and monetization strategies. He cited recent successful single-player games like Baldur's Gate 3, Kingdom Come: Deliverance 2, and Clair Obscur: Expedition 33 as evidence that traditional single-player experiences can still thrive. The latest trailer for Judas, released in January 2024, emphasizes player choices. A fourth installment of the Bioshock franchise is in development at Cloud Chamber, featuring a team from Irrational and 2K Marin.
